<br />DEVELOPPIENT LuND EXTRACTION PIINING PERMIT
<br />THIS PERMIT is issued this 13th day of August, 1979 by the Mined Land
<br />Reclamation Board, Department of Natural Resources, State of Colorado.
<br />W ITN E S S E T H
<br />WHEREAS, Flatiron Materials desires to conduct a(n) mining
<br />operation, known as East Rigden , Eor the purpose of extracting open
<br />mined sand and gravel
<br />WHEREAS, on May 22 , 19 79, F. M. C. "FILED" an
<br />application,a reclamation plan and map, and the required fee, as required by law; and
<br />WIlEREAS, on July 26 , 19 79, the Mined Land Reclamation Board approved
<br />Flatiron Materials, Inc. application and set bond; and
<br />WHEREAS, on August 13, 19 79, the :fined Land Reclamation Board accepted
<br />surety submitted by F. M. C, and such date shall be considered the
<br />date of issuance of the permit and the anniversary date for all other purposes; and
<br />WHEREAS, the Mined Land Reclamation Board has made a finding, for the purposes
<br />of issuing this permit, that:
<br />1) the application complies with the requirements of the Colorado
<br />:fined Land Reclamation Act and all applicable local, state and
<br />Federal laws; and,
<br />2) the operation will not adversely affect the stability of any
<br />significant, valuable, and permanent man-made structures located
<br />within two hundred feet of the affected land, except where there
<br />is an agreement between the operator and the persons having an
<br />interest in the structure chat damage to the structure is to be
<br />compensated for by the operator; and,
<br />3) the pro posed, mining operations and reclamation can be carried out
<br />in conformance with the requirements of C.R.S. 1973, 34-32-116, as
<br />amended (1976 Sess. Laws H.B. 1065); and
<br />47HEREAS, for the purposes of issuing this permit, the operator has made a
<br />satisfactory showing to the Board that he will employ during and after his
<br />open mining operations procedures reasonably designed to minimize
<br />as much as practicable the disruption from the open mining operations
<br />and will provide for the rehabilitation of the affected land through the rehabilitation
<br />of plant cover, soil stability, water resources, and other measures appropriate to the
<br />subsequent beneficial use of such mined and reclaimed lands; and that in the event
<br />of the failure of his proposed reclamation plan, he will take whatever measures which,
<br />may be necessary in order to assure the success of reclamation of the lands affected
<br />by his open mining operations; and,
<br />IdHEREAS, for the purposes of issuing this permit, a copy of the application
<br />approved by the Mined Land Reclamation Board of the State of Colorado is attached
<br />to this permit and thereby becomes a part of the terms hereof.
<br />NOId, THEREFORE, pursuant to the authority set forth in the Colorado Mined
<br />Land Reclamation Act, Article 32 of Title 34, C.R.S. 1973, as amended, (1976
<br />Sess. Laws H.B. 1065) the Mined Land Reclamation Board of the State of Colorado
<br />hereby issues a life of the mine permit to F. M. C. to eng;ige
<br />in open mining Eor the purpose of extracting open
<br />mined sand G gravel on the following parcel of ground, to wit:
<br />Part of W 1/2 Section 28, T7NR68W, 6th P.M., Larimer County, Colorado.
